Course Content

• Next-Generation Sequencing (NGS) Platforms and Data Analysis
• Genomic DNA Extraction and Quantification Techniques
• Bioinformatics for Genomic Data Interpretation and Variant Annotation
• Advanced Molecular Diagnostics: PCR, qPCR, and Multiplex Assays
• Cytogenetic and Karyotyping Methods
• Microarray Technology and Applications in Genomic Medicine
• Principles of Genetic Counseling and Ethical Considerations
• Quality Assurance and Quality Control in Genomic Testing Laboratories
• Clinical Interpretation of Genomic Test Results and Report Writing

Career path

Career Role (Genomic Medicine Testing) Description
Genomic Data Analyst Analyze large genomic datasets, interpret results, and contribute to research using bioinformatics and advanced statistical methods. High demand in UK research institutions and pharmaceutical companies.
Clinical Genomics Scientist Perform genomic testing procedures, interpret results, and provide expert advice to healthcare professionals, ensuring accurate genomic data analysis for patient diagnosis and treatment. Key role in NHS genomic medicine initiatives.
Bioinformatician (Genomics Focus) Develop and apply computational methods to analyze genomic data; crucial in genomics research and development of new diagnostic tools; high demand in research settings and tech companies focusing on genomics.
Genomic Laboratory Technician Perform laboratory procedures in genomic testing, maintain high standards, and ensure data quality in a regulated environment. Entry-level role with growth opportunities in specialized genomic testing techniques.
